Ro Water Treatment in Louisville, KY

RO water treatment services focus on installing and maintaining reverse osmosis systems to improve water quality for residential properties. These services typically cover projects such as installing new RO units, upgrading existing systems, and providing routine maintenance to ensure optimal performance. Homeowners often seek this service to eliminate contaminants like chlorine, lead, and other impurities, resulting in cleaner, better-tasting water for drinking, cooking, and household use. Before requesting RO water treatment, property owners usually want to understand the system’s capacity, maintenance requirements, and how it can address specific water quality concerns based on local water sources.

Understanding the scope of RO water treatment projects helps homeowners determine if this solution suits their needs. It’s common for property owners to inquire about system lifespan, filtration capabilities, and any necessary upgrades to existing plumbing. Clear information about the installation process, ongoing upkeep, and the potential benefits of improved water purity can assist in making an informed decision. Properly assessing these factors ensures that the chosen system effectively meets household demands and provides consistent, high-quality water.

FAQ

Ro Water Treatment Questions

What is RO water treatment? RO water treatment uses a semi-permeable membrane to remove contaminants and impurities from tap water, providing cleaner drinking water for homes and properties.

Why choose RO water treatment for a property? It effectively reduces harmful substances like lead, chlorine, and bacteria, improving water quality and taste for household use.

What types of projects typically require RO water treatment? Residential water purification systems, well water filtration, and upgrades to existing water treatment setups often involve RO technology.

What should property owners know about installing RO systems? Proper installation ensures optimal performance and maintenance, helping to maintain water purity and system longevity.
